WebTo change the refresh rate Select Start > Settings > System > Display > Advanced display . Next to Choose a refresh rate, select the rate you want. The refresh rates that appear depend on your display and what it supports. Select laptops and external displays will support higher refresh rates. WebDec 24, 2024 · To refresh Finder do one of the following: Click on the Apple menu, choose Force Quit, click on the Finder icon and choose Relaunch. Press Command-Option-Esc, choose Finder and then click Relaunch. If the Finder is hanging, Ctrl-click on the Finder icon in the Dock and choose Relaunch. How to refresh Spotlight?
